## Broker upgrade: Quillbus 5 -> 6

Drain consumers first. Stop the Tarnwick ingest workers, wait for queue depth zero, snapshot the mnesia-style store, then roll brokers one at a time. Version 6 changes the default ack mode — explicit acks required. Rollback window is 30 minutes; after that, mixed-version clusters corrupt routing tables. Apply the following broker configuration before restarting the first node.

config for kafof-bawef:
holath:
  log_level: debug
  metrics_host: metrics.holath.qorvelsys.internal
  pin: 2191
  pool_size: 32

Runbook: Thornbeck string extraction

Scope: `xstrings` script, runs pre-merge on localization-touching diffs. Reviewer duties: confirm new strings carry context comments; reject bare concatenation. If extraction fails, rerun with `--strict` off to isolate the offending template, then fix the tag — never suppress the check. Catalog drift over 2% blocks the merge. Full failure codes and the escalation matrix are listed here.

dashboard of yahaf-kajep = https://jira.zemvarsys.internal/display/projects/browse/browse/a08b

Retrying Failed Exports — Ledgerline

As a new contractor, please review the export retry policy before triggering any manual runs. Failed exports are retried automatically three times with exponential backoff; manual retries should only follow a verified upstream fix, never during an active incident. If an export fails a fourth time, notify the data operations group at the address below.

escalation mailbox, hadug-bajog: sormir@norvalabs.internal

**Q: What happens when Mailcull marks a bounce as permanent?**

Mailcull, our email bounce processor, classifies hard bounces after three consecutive failures and suppresses the address automatically. Soft bounces are retried for 72 hours. If the suppression list itself becomes corrupted, restore it from the encrypted nightly snapshot in the Thornfield backup bucket. Restoring requires the team recovery passphrase, which is kept directly below this entry for emergencies.

unlock words, kahof-bahap: praax-ulaix